Trước kia Tý và Tèo là hai bạn cùng lớp còn bây giờ hai bạn học khác trường nhau. Cứ mỗi sáng, đúng 6 giờ cả hai chỉ đi từ nhà tới trường của mình theo con đường mất ít thời gian nhất. Hôm nay, Tý muốn gặp Tèo trên đường đi học. Tý và Tèo có thể gặp nhau tại một nút giao thông nào đó nếu họ đến nút giao thông này tại cùng một thời điểm.
Cho biết sơ đồ giao thông của thành phố gồm N nút giao thông được đánh số từ 1 đến N và M tuyến đường phố (mỗi đường phố nối 2 nút giao thông). Biết rằng nhà của Tý và Tèo cũng như trường của hai bạn đều nằm ở các nút giao thông.
Yêu cầu: Hãy tìm thời gian sớm nhất mà Tý và Tèo có thể gặp nhau trên đường đi học.
Dữ liệu: Vào từ tệp văn bản test.inp gồm:
Giả sử sơ đồ giao thông trong thành phố đảm bảo để có thể đi từ một nút giao thông bất kỳ đến tất cả các nút còn lại.
Kết quả: Ghi ra tệp văn bản test.out thời gian sớm nhất mà Tý và Tèo có thể gặp nhau theo cách đi như trên. Nếu hai bạn không gặp nhau trên đường đi thì ghi ra -1.
| # | test.inp | test.out |
|---|---|---|
| 1 |